CMRE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2024 in Review

153 of the 6,942 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Costamare (CMRE) for Q1 2024, worth a combined $305M — up 5.6% from $289M a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 30 funds opened new CMRE positions and 21 closed out — a net gain of 9 holders — while 51 added to existing stakes and 46 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Arrowstreet Capital, adding an estimated $4.37M. The largest seller was Morgan Stanley, cutting an estimated $16.7M.
